Jump And Shout is an unreleased track by Graham Central Station recorded in 1997 at Paisley Park Studios in Chanhassen, Minnesota, for inclusion on the album GCS 2000. Horn overdubs took place on 3 December 1997, also at Paisley Park Studios. Jump And Shout was written by Larry Graham, but it is believed that produced and performed musically on the track.
Jump And Shout was placed as the second track on an early configuration of Graham Central Station’s GCS 2000, but was removed as the album progressed. It was played from CD by the DJ during an intermission at an aftershow on 1 January 1998 (a.m.), The Roxy, Houston, TX, USA. The track remains unreleased.
